What is the circumference of a 4 cm diameter?

1) The formula for finding the circumference of a circle looks like this: L = 2 * pi * r or L = d * pi. Where the number pi is a constant number equal to 3.14 (rounded to hundredths), r is the radius of the circle;
2) In the formula L = d * pi, instead of d, substitute the number 4 centimeters and find the length of this circle L = 4 * 3.14 = 12.56 centimeters.
Answer: 12.56 centimeters.
